#419ed8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#419ed8 is composed of 25.5% red, 62%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.9% cyan, 26.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 203 degrees, a saturation of 65.9% and a lightness of 55.1%. #419ed8 color hex could be obtained by blending #82ffff with #003db1.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#419ed8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#419ed8 has RGB values of R:65, G:158, B:216 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.27,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 4300504.

Shades and Tints of #419ed8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010405 is the darkest color, while #f4f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#419ed8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878e92 is the less saturated color, while #1ea6fb is the most saturated one.
